What Is a Bean Pole? The Ectomorph Body Type Explained

The colloquial term “bean pole” refers to a tall, slender physique with a noticeably linear shape. This informal description characterizes a person who appears naturally thin and often finds it challenging to gain weight or muscle mass. The physical characteristics described by “bean pole” align closely with a recognized classification system for human body types called somatotyping. This system provides a technical framework for understanding this particular build.

Defining the Ectomorph Body Type

The “bean pole” build is scientifically categorized as the Ectomorph somatotype, one of three primary body types proposed by psychologist William Sheldon in the 1940s. The Ectomorph is defined by a tendency toward linearity and a delicate bone structure, distinct from the more muscular Mesomorph and the rounder Endomorph. People with this body type typically exhibit a light frame, including narrow shoulders and hips, and long, thin limbs.

Specific physical features of the Ectomorph include a smaller bone circumference, such as at the wrists and ankles, and a low percentage of both body fat and muscle mass. This body composition gives the appearance of being naturally lean, often with a flat chest and a smaller overall trunk. The difficulty in gaining mass, whether muscle or fat, is a defining trait, leading to the nickname “hardgainer” within the fitness community.

Unique Metabolism and Health Factors

The slender Ectomorph physique is linked to a fast metabolism, or a high basal metabolic rate (BMR). This rapid metabolic function means the body burns calories quickly, making it difficult to maintain the caloric surplus needed for significant weight or muscle gain. This high energy turnover allows many Ectomorphs to consume a large volume of food without readily storing it as body fat.

While being naturally lean may seem advantageous, the Ectomorph body type presents specific health considerations. The challenge in building and maintaining muscle mass can be a concern, as muscle tissue is important for overall strength and metabolic health. A long-term lack of sufficient muscle mass and low body weight can negatively correlate with bone mineral density.

Studies show a negative correlation between ectomorphy and bone density measurements, suggesting a heightened risk of developing low bone density, or osteopenia, and in some cases, osteoporosis. Health monitoring should focus on body composition, ensuring adequate lean mass to support skeletal health. As metabolism slows with age, especially with low muscle mass, Ectomorphs may also experience an unhealthy gain in body fat later in life, often accumulating around the midsection.

Optimizing Nutrition and Exercise

To address the metabolic challenges of the Ectomorph body type, a tailored approach to nutrition and exercise is beneficial. The fast metabolism necessitates a high caloric intake to create the surplus needed for muscle hypertrophy and weight gain. This often means consuming nutrient-dense foods and eating more frequently, such as including two to three high-calorie snacks between main meals.

The optimal macronutrient ratio for gaining mass is typically higher in carbohydrates, which fuel intense training sessions. A common recommendation is to aim for approximately 50–60% of daily calories from complex carbohydrates, 25% from protein, and 25% from healthy fats. Protein intake is important for muscle tissue repair and growth, often targeting at least one gram of protein per pound of body weight daily.

Exercise should focus on resistance training to stimulate muscle growth and improve bone density. Compound exercises, such as squats, deadlifts, and bench presses, are highly effective for building overall strength and mass because they work multiple muscle groups simultaneously. Conversely, excessive cardiovascular exercise should be limited, as it burns calories that prevent mass gain.
